/**
## Usage Example
```cpp
#include <FastLED.h>
#include <fl/task.h>
void setup() {
// Create a recurring task that runs every 100ms
auto task = fl::task::every_ms(100, FL_TRACE)
.then([]() {
// Task logic here
})
.catch_([](const fl::Error& e) {
// Error handling here
});
// Add task to scheduler
fl::Scheduler::instance().add_task(task);
}
void loop() {
// Execute ready tasks
fl::Scheduler::instance().update();
// Yield for other operations
fl::async_yield();
}
```
*/

// Static builders
static task every_ms(int interval_ms);
static task every_ms(int interval_ms, const fl::TracePoint& trace);
static task at_framerate(int fps);
static task at_framerate(int fps, const fl::TracePoint& trace);
// For most cases you want after_frame() instead of before_frame(), unless you
// are doing operations that need to happen right before the frame is rendered.
// Most of the time for ui stuff (button clicks, etc) you want after_frame(), so it
// can be available for the next iteration of loop().
static task before_frame();
static task before_frame(const fl::TracePoint& trace);
// Example: auto task = fl::task::after_frame().then([]() {...}
static task after_frame();
static task after_frame(const fl::TracePoint& trace);
// Example: auto task = fl::task::after_frame([]() {...}
static task after_frame(function<void()> on_then);
static task after_frame(function<void()> on_then, const fl::TracePoint& trace);
